What shelf load capacity stickers are

Shelf load capacity stickers are labels affixed to shelving to indicate the maximum safe load per shelf level. They help prevent overload, support safe storage practices, and aid in regulatory compliance. In practice, these labels can appear on industrial metal racks, wooden shelves, and commercial display units. The sticker typically lists the weight limit, the units (for example kilograms or pounds), and often the shelf level or position on a rack. Some designs also include a caution or a reference code to help maintenance teams track replacements. For engineers and technicians, stickers simplify capacity verification during audits and when rearranging inventory after a change in process. For everyday users, clear labeling reduces guesswork and minimizes the risk of dropped items or shelf collapse. Shelf load capacity stickers are most effective when combined with documented loading procedures, routine inspections, and a culture of safety that treats every weight limit as a hard constraint.

How to read shelf load capacity stickers

Reading a shelf load capacity sticker is straightforward once you know what to look for. Start with the maximum weight value; this is the limit the shelf surface can safely hold in static conditions. Check the units to confirm whether the rating uses kilograms or pounds, and note if the value is per shelf or per load across multiple shelves. Some stickers also indicate the recommended distribution pattern, such as evenly distributed weight or limits for heavy items at the front. If the sticker references a date, pay attention to replacement intervals or refurbishment cycles. In warehouses, you may encounter color coding or icons that summarize whether a shelf is optimized for light, medium, or heavy loads. If a sticker is damaged or unreadable, treat the shelf as if a stricter limit applies until a replacement can be installed. Training staff to read and interpret these details consistently reduces misloads and improves safety outcomes.

Practical guidelines for sticker design

Effective shelf load capacity stickers balance clarity and durability. Use large, bold numerals and high-contrast colors to ensure legibility from a distance. Include the unit of measure, the shelf level designation, and the approved load value. A simple layout helps users scan quickly: a top line with the weight limit and unit, a second line with the shelf level, and an optional code for replacement history. Choose weather- and chemical-resistant materials if shelves are exposed to humidity, cleaners, or chemicals. An adhesive that tolerates varying temperatures is essential for cold storage or outdoor setups. Consider adding a small QR code that links to the facility’s loading procedures or a maintenance log. Finally, standardize the sticker format across all shelving units to minimize confusion and enable faster audits.

Placement, durability, and environmental considerations

Place shelf load capacity stickers where they are most visible to staff: at the front edge, on the uprights near the shelf lip, or at a fixed height on the rack frame. Avoid placing stickers on moving parts or enclosure doors where they can be rubbed off. Durability is key: laminated vinyl, overlaminates, or UV-resistant coatings extend life in bright, UV-exposed environments or in dusty spaces. In cold storage, ensure the adhesive maintains tack at low temperatures, and replace stickers promptly if they peel or crack. Regular cleaning with non-abrasive cleaners can preserve legibility, but avoid solvents that can degrade adhesive or ink. For multi-shift operations, rotating staff should be trained to check labels during shift changes so that new loads don’t exceed the marked capacity.

Maintenance: inspection, replacement, and record-keeping

Create a simple inspection schedule that includes periodic checks of all shelf stickers for fading, peeling, or legibility. Replace any damaged labels immediately and maintain a log of replacements with dates and shelf identifiers. If a rack is reconfigured or the load method changes, update the sticker content or replace the label to reflect the new capacity. Use a standardized process for removing old stickers and applying new ones to avoid residue or misalignment. Staff training should reinforce that no load is permitted beyond the sticker rating and that violations require escalation.

Case examples and implementation steps

To implement shelf load capacity stickers effectively, start with a site survey of shelving units and inventory profiles. Step one is to photograph each shelf, note its intended loads, and determine if any units require upgraded hardware. Step two is to design a uniform sticker set that includes weight limit, units, shelf level, and replacement date. Step three is to print and apply labels, ensuring clean, dry surfaces and proper alignment. Step four is to train staff on reading values and following the labeling system, and step five is to conduct quarterly audits to verify compliance. As a practical example, a warehouse with mixed heavy and light items can implement color-coded stickers to distinguish heavy-load zones from lighter ones. The Load Capacity team recommends starting with a pilot on a small subset of shelves and expanding once staff are proficient.
